Father Arrested Following Son’s Involvement in Georgia School Incident

Marietta, GA — The father of a teenage boy accused of opening fire at a Georgia high school was arrested Thursday, intensifying the legal ramifications of a case that has already gripped the local community. Authorities stated that the man was taken into custody following revelations of his possible connection to the incident, including that the firearm used in the school shooting might have been accessible to his son at their home.

The incident, which unfolded earlier in the week at a high school south of Atlanta, left one student injured, causing panic and initiating an immediate lockdown. The swift response by law enforcement led to the quick apprehension of the teenage suspect on school premises. The injured student is currently receiving medical treatment and is reported to be in stable condition.

During the investigation, detectives discovered evidence suggesting that the firearm used in the shooting was owned by the suspect’s father, and had not been securely stored. Under Georgia law, gun owners are required to keep firearms secured from minors, and failure to do so can lead to charges, especially if a minor uses the weapon to commit a crime.

The father, whose identity has not been disclosed to protect the minor involved in the case, faces charges related to reckless conduct and contributing to the delinquency of a minor.
